OECD Obesity Update 2017: Obesity rates are expected to increase further
Despite policies put in place in OECD countries for a number of years, the number of 15-year-olds who report to be overweight or obese has steadily increased since 2000 in the majority of countries. OECD projections show a steady increase in obesity rates until at least 2030.
